When you are trying to start it, does smoke come out of the tailpipe? If not this is a sign the cylinders are not getting any fuel injected. It will be light and you might have to let it crank for a few seconds.
Hi, checked my truck & it doesn't move the tach. Also, it doesn't smoke when cranking. If the sensor isn't working will it also stop the fuel? Thanks Charles
Yes, if the sensor isn't working it won't allow the injectors to fire. See the links in my signature for info on changing the sensor. CAS.1, there is a fuse that powers the PCM that is on the same circuit as the fuel heater element. I don't know the number. I have seen the fuel heater element burn out and blow that fuse. Have you checked your oil level?
